Taillon Rules Himself Out for Rest of 2026 Season With Elbow Issue
The Blue Jays righty, already on the IL with elbow inflammation, says he's done for the year and will seek another medical opinion from Dr. Keith Meister.

Jameson Taillon went on the IL last week with elbow inflammation and has now stated definitively he will not pitch again in 2026. He is scheduled to consult with Dr. Keith Meister for an additional opinion. Taillon has a significant UCL history, having undergone Tommy John surgery twice (2014 and 2019). He acknowledged briefly fearing his career might be over after feeling discomfort mid-start, though he says he is now committed to forming a recovery plan.
